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18876 169717 46106885
923 16170893456
923 16170893456
7458054402 081597384 4027309
All about undefined
Interested in learning more?
923 16170893456
7458054402 081597384 4027309
See more
9148201 951252 487930
06 8552857 23158
See more
58127212 54273
405070850 4852974244 31481681
See more